Puzzlegram: A Serious Game Designed for the Elderly in Group Settings

An original serious game prototype named ‘Puzzlegram’ is created for the elderly demographic in group settings as the target players. Puzzlegram is precisely designed to accentuate memory, auditory interaction as well as haptic response to visual signals with the use of music. Music is introduced as a key component for establishing the game design that provides a source of meaningful contextualization—familiar music from the past—for setting the game mechanics, which facilitated the construction of the serious game design process. The discussion topics raised include the need to design serious games for fostering meaningful interactions, as well as developing a thorough framework for constructing purposeful design for serious games. A potential integral of artificial intelligence to Puzzlegram may involve assigning a novel dimension to its existing problem-solving task by adapting to varying states of cognitive function for monitoring purposes based on an individual’s interaction with the game.
